
Threats of Heavy Rainfall, Severe Thunderstorms and Dangerous Heat
Several complexes of thunderstorms, some severe with heavy rainfall, will impact areas from the northern Plains, Great Lakes, Ohio Valley to the mid-Atlantic. This threat will shift toward the Carolinas on Friday. Heavy rainfall, remnants of Edouard, continues for portions of eastern Texas through today. In-between these systems, a dome of high pressure and heat for central and eastern states. Read More >
